Ingredients
- Vanilla ice cream 2 scoops
- Espresso coffee 1 shot
- Frangelico hazelnut liqueur 50ml
- Top with broken biscotti
Method
An affogato (meaning drowned) is a coffee-based dessert. It usually takes the form of a scoop of vanilla gelato or ice cream topped with a shot of hot espresso – but why not add a twist to the ever popular Italian sweet.
